Fullcalendar popover. Each popover contains a button that closes said popover when clicked. Fullcalendar popover

 
 Each popover contains a button that closes said popover when clickedFullcalendar popover Explore this online FullCalendar DayGrid with Bootstrap Tooltip sandbox and experiment with it yourself using our interactive online playground

acerix added the Confirmed label on Jun 1, 2020. 1. Each popover contains a button that closes said popover when clicked. I'm trying to add a popover to an event in a resource timeline and I would like to know what the correct way is to do that. so how can i bind touch event on calendar and show data. 6. Maybe you want a deep partial of EventContentArg, but probably you want to enforce that args matches the expected props. Bootstrap popover clipped to extent of containing div. Specifically, you can set the enabled property to false for the popover type. Also make sure you've added this component to entryComponents array of your NgModule: @NgModule ( { imports: [ BrowserModule, FullCalendarModule,. DOM. Firstly, you should NOT use CSS customization if a setting already exists for what you want to achieve. I'm using fullcalendar to display a month view which shows the time and title of events (and a popover showing the description when hovered). Also, control where events are allowed to go: Green areas are allowed for every event. It's powerful and lightweight and suitable for just about anything. So you just replace your function to this: const handlePopover = (_, event) => { // NO: setAnchorEl (1) setAnchorEl (event. Generated content is inserted inside the inner. dateClick not emitted in fullcalendar angular. The rest will show up in a popover. 3) even in v3, the first argument to the callback was event, not element. title, placement: 'top', trigger: 'hover', content: 'more info on the popover if you want', container: 'body' }); }. When an event is clicked a popover is shown with information of the event and a button to open a page to view more details. 2. I was trying to render a pop up on eventclick but for some reason it does not trigger the popup. Seems to work - maybe create an issue on the fullcalendar project page regarding the issue? eventAfterRender fiddle and eventRender fiddle The popover may get fixed moving it to eventRender as well, didn't try that. event. For each event, define a popover that will be triggered on click. 2. So, now when I click +'x'more button, event container popup is coming at the bottom of the screen. 0. Fullcalendar popover. Use this online fullcalendar-popover playground to view and fork fullcalendar-popover example apps and templates on CodeSandbox. I could successfully display the popover on dayclick and eventclick in monthly view. Link for fullcalendar demo : more cols will break the row with the header, because this is set to a fixed colspan. In the following example, an alert box will appear whenever the user clicks on a day: var calendar = new Calendar(calendarEl, { dateClick: function() { alert('a day has been clicked!');arshaw Type-Feature Discussing labels on Aug 19, 2015. Handlers (sometimes called “callbacks”) are sort of like options, but they are functions that get called whenever something special happens. popover. fc-event divs/spans within the calendar, I need to access these DOM elements to run . yuan9090 mentioned this issue on Jun 16, 2020. js:1:163760) at t. Connect and share knowledge within a single location that is structured and easy to search. Also, any utilities that normally would be accessed via @fullcalendar/core can now be accessed via @fullcalendar/vue. Fullcalendar add tooltip to events. It is exposed in various places of the API such as getEventById and provides methods for dynamic manipulation. I'm using the basicWeek but if I set:. For example, developers often include a description field for use in callbacks such as eventRender. Using the below function in calendar instantiation we can click on 'more button' to change to day view. For each event, define a popover that will be triggered on click. I am loading tooltips on my events; however, the tooltips don't seem to work inside of the "eventLimit" popover. asked May 12, 2015 at 5:53. 2. start, animation: true, delay: 300, content: event. 2. you can change the event data or payload with one more object for tooltip stuff and use it in your js like#popover #reactfullcalendar #fullcalendar #tutorial In this video i'm going to show you guys how to add popover to fullcalendar. I want to display a pop over on the event click of latest fullcalendar implemented in angular. Resource Data. Answer to this requirement is that currently Full Calendar is not providing feature to display events as colored dots. Calendar(calendarEl, { plugins: [ 'dayGrid', 'timeGrid', 'list', 'bootstrap', 'googleCalendar' ], themeSystem: 'bootstrap', googleCalendarApiKey: 'xxxxxxx', events: { googleCalendarId: 'xxxxxxx' }, eventRender: function(event, element) { $(element). io. ) To add icons to all calendar events:"popover" (the default) Displays a rectangular panel over the cell with a full list of events for that day. paused-event div, . xxxxxxxxxx. javascript. 3. I've got a fullcalendar using the eventLimit feature, but there are so many events that when I click 'more' it scrolls off the calendar and I can't see the events at the bottom. like this;1. Angular 6 fullCalendar Display popover on mouseover event. eventChange: function (changeInfo) { event_source = calendar. 2. HTML preprocessors can make writing HTML more powerful or convenient. 3. I'm trying to get popovers to display the event information using FulCalendar 3. Teams. When not all events will fit in a given day, you can display the excess events in a small window that will show up when the user clicks a “more” link. This will prevent you from needing to import the core package. Fullcalendar event placement and layout. I have a problem for event click show the selected data with FullCalendar function in the popup modal. 3 @SergueiFedorov can you try jQuery. 1. I have tried ngbPopover but unlike ngbModal, ngbPopover doesn't have an open method that would simply open up the popover by calling it's method since it's a directive. We have 12 events as limit: But when the popover opens the top of the popover is probably centered somewhere near item 6 instead of being completely visible. 2. arrow will become the popover's arrow. I am using FullCalendar to render events from PHP/MySQL and all is working fine. Here is my fiddle I even tried setting the popover to be called on the parent (ex. If there were another jQuery included after the Bootstrap JS, $ would be getting redefined and $. Fullcalendar bootstrap popover gets hidden. 1. According to the documentation i simply have to add in the Advanced Options the following statement: eventRender: function (info) { var tooltip = new Tooltip (info. – ADyson. e) If the user click on a particular date , it should show a empty popover to enter the title and description of the event. It works fine in my dayClick event, but nothing happens in my eventLimitClick. here is the screenshot . segPopover. Closed. Angular 6 fullCalendar Display popover on mouseover event. When the number of events exceeds eventMaxStack, a rectangle is drawn that represents the hidden events. 1. Fullcalendar bootstrap popover gets hidden. Also, this could very well be a problem with some other stuff I have going on in my. The code does make the popover appears above the cells, however, on clicking the popovers, the cells underneath it are selected rather than the popovers themselves. With CodeSandbox, you can easily learn how favger has skilfully integrated different packages and frameworks to. 5. Then the events appear in the popover. When I try replacing the following code:FullCalendar will not modify or delete them but also won't render them. var calendarEl = document. Assuming you have no control over the browser side and therefor cannot disable that feature. view name A literal string name of any of the available views. I tried a few approaches. 6. Teams. I tried to call the popover on eventMount and event click callbacks. See a live demo with Tooltip. So, for this release, jQuery 1. When I add a new Class to an event (based on some programming calculations) I do this: event. Thanks to this plugin you will be able to easily create new events, manage current events, move existing events between other days, and integrate with your Google Calendar. It is having layout issues related to what seems to be zIndex. updateSize (fullcalendar. What you can do is try npm install rxjs@6 rxjs-compat@6 --save in the product directory, which will basically install a compatibility layer for dependencies. The rest will show up in a popover. Universal: compatible with mouse, keyboard, and touch inputs. Besides displaying events as labels, you can have them show up in a pop-over. Visibility is not set to 'hidden'. JQuery Fullcalendar to filter event based on select dropdown. paused-event span { background: #71CCBF; border-color: #65B7AB; } The background color changes correctly, the. After that first ~few frames, it's fine. 7. I'm trying to add a popup window above any event the mouse hovers. ts. For the color part of the issue - try coloring it with eventRender instead of eventAfterRender. Before getting started, take a look at the. componentDidMount (fullcalendar. I don't know Angular at all but I would guess it may not bind events to arbitrary HTML which is inserted dynamically from a string. js is the complete tooltip, popover, dropdown, and menu solution for the web, powered by Popper. you've tagged this with fullCalendar-4. When you click the "+2 more" button, then click on an event inside that . additionally, since i created a custom component for the. 2. 1. fc-content. 2. Modified 4 years, 6 months ago. The right way to declare a event:Fullcalendar dateclick and eventclick events are not firing. fc-list-item') [0]. change youreventDidMount to. When NOT to use CSS customization. fullcalendar-react Public. With the modification of a single line you could alter the fullcalendar. $ cd angularfullcalendarbootstrap // Go inside project folder. that is the updated fullcalendar. Then you can clearly see where in the page structure it is sitting. 1. If to show the popover only when the event is "eventClick"(FullCalendar's event), then the popover appears ONLY after the second click, for each event. For example, it can change its appearance via jQuery’s . fullcalendar; popover; Share. It would be awesome if the 'eventLimit' text & color could dynamically change based on the events for the day. The following functionality will be implemented to build PHP event calendar with FullCalendar. Uncaught (in promise) TypeError: Cannot read properties of null (reading 'getBoundingClientRect') at t. dayPopoverFormat. FullCalendar. It is having layout issues related to what seems to be zIndex. An integer value will limit the events to a specific number of rows. The definite solution is to upgrade to the last 2. find ('. It'll cover the entire screen. popover in fullcalendar not getting dismissed. You can use it as a template to jumpstart your development with this pre-built solution. dayPopoverFormat. viewRender: function (view, element) { var cols = element. The top position is rendered as something like -222px. Set it up through the calendar: {popover: true} object inside the view option. I've been using an older version of fullcalendar and am having trouble recreating my calendars in the current version of fullCalendar. eventContent - a Content Injection Input. Using the below function in calendar instantiation we can click on 'more button' to change to day view. 2. closeHint Describes the “X” icon on the event popover. 1. 2. More info » Also, feature: included TypeScript definitions ; fix: Class instances in extendedProps are converted to plain objects ; Angular Connector Explore this online fullcalendar-popover-solution sandbox and experiment with it yourself using our interactive online playground. Old fullCalendar v3. eventMaxStack 5. will address this with a proper bugfix in the future, but your workaround works, however it disables the ability to scroll vertically if. It works fine displaying event detail when I'm hovering the event, but when I'm trying to resize the event, the popover created every time i resize the event and the popover getting stuck yet never fade out. Fullcalendar popover. Docs Event Popover. Follow edited May 9, 2018 at 8:26. 2. FullCalendar に興味があったので触ってみました。. 1. 0. I have seen the documentation and understand the extendedProp created in the event object, but I'm having trouble recreating this action from a JSON result of events. Event Popover. Now onClick of event i want to show details in popup instead of opening in browser, i tried many callbacks but didn't work. 0 fc-more(2+ more) popup over ride. Resource Data. When not all events will fit in a given day, you can display the excess events in a small window that will show up when the user clicks a “more” link. fullcalendar do not work with vue 2. Teams. This UI component only applies to month view, basic view, and the “all-day” slot of agenda view. Make sure, that your popover div does not contain position: fixed. Add a comment. Adding Pop-Up to Event in Fullcalendar API. I tried to remove the body of the click does not work. It is fine when there are enough resources. Just give your "upper" element the following onMouseDown-handler: onMouseDown={(evt) => { evt. 2. Dec 14, 2015 at 11:14. Here is my fiddle I even tried setting the popover to be called on the parent (ex. You can use height: 100% and width: 100% for convenience. getEventSourceById (changeInfo. The problem really is the HTML generated by fullcalendar. In, dayGrid view, the max number of events within a given day, not counting the +more link. I'll demonstrate a couple of different ways you can do this with FullCalendar v4 & Font-Awesome using the eventRender callback. Q&A for work. Googleで引っかかる情報はバージョンが古いようで最新版 (4. It provides the logic and optional styling of elements that "pop out" from the flow of the document and float next to a target element. "day" Goes to a day view, as determined by the views in the headerToolbar. "More links" and popover are working. Modified 3 months ago. How to hide events in fullCalendar? Using the latest version of fullCalendar (5. Full-sized drag & drop event calendar in JavaScript. componentDidMount (fullcalendar. FullCalendar js add event. eventDidMount: function (info) { $(info. The event prop expects an array of event objects with keys of title, start, and an optional end. Limits the number of events displayed on a day. here is the screenshot . Related. "week" Goes to a week view, as determined by the views in the headerToolbar. They can be provided in the following formats. 0. Fullcalendar with Twitter Bootstrap Popover. No problem. Then you can make all popover behave the same (mostly because you are delegating the. I'm trying to add a popover to an event in a resource timeline and I would like to know what the correct way is to do that. fc-day-past . Import the props type or use the roundabout way let args: React. Use . $(this). 7. I am using FullCalendar 3. Fullcalendar - Add custom fields from JSON feed to javascript object Hot Network Questions What would a mountain and desert made out of diamond, glass, or a see-through fantasy material look like?Old question, but here's how I "fixed" it. where click event is working on Desktop view but not in mobile device because on mobile phone touch event works. Connect and share knowledge within a single location that is structured and easy to search. When clicking an event, a popover shows just like I want it too. Inside the popover, there're multiple divs that get hidden/shown depending on which view the user is on (i. calendar', 'ui. Ask Question Asked 9 years, 10 months ago. Adding Pop-Up to Event in Fullcalendar API. popover event occurs). 8. moreLinkClassNames - a ClassName Input for adding classNames. Using the 'eventDidMount' event render hook I am calling a JS function for popovers on each event to show details of the event. Just like with dayMaxEventRows, if true is specified, the number of events will be limited to the height of the day cell. 0. el). css files. html nothing is happin This is my code for calendar. For anyone who is still a little confused: Here is how it works to toggle the popover after you have gotten it to show, select the same button you used to trigger it and call . Fullcalendar with Vue without CLI. FullCalendar. Triggered when the user mouses out of an event. I have tried the $ (". Timeline View. Learn more about TeamsFullCalendar popover get hidden under div. Fetch events data from the MySQL database. if I remember Matt's FullCalendar integration was one done before FileMaker 19 javascript functions came in. fc-more-popover, you can't close any custom popover using the close button. 2. eventLimit. fullcalendar; popover; fullcalendar-scheduler; Share. For more info see the official site and the Github repository . The top position is rendered as something like -222px. Teams. Already have an account? Having the option to enable +more link (event limit) for agendaDay and agendaWeek views. To figure this stuff out I usually use ie or firefoxe's dev tools or firebug (hit f12 when viewing the results on the site). Viewed 229 times 0 When I have many events in my calendar. Bootstrap popover get stuck in fullcalendar. The eventRender callback function can modify element. Usage of eventMouseEnter in V4 of fullcalendar. fn. . js is the complete tooltip, popover, dropdown, and menu solution for the web, powered by Popper. Modified 6 years, 2 months ago. open (context) later. popover('hide') Hides an element’s popover. Source Code: pin under comm. Labels added: Type-Feature. event. preventDefault() }} This prevents the fullcalendar-more. 1. paused-event, . fc. find ('. module('calendarModule', [ 'ui. el, { title: info. 6. Amitabha Ghosh Amitabha Ghosh. I am using full calendar in my angular project to display events . Instead, FullCalendar's JS is responsible for injecting its own CSS. By default, the content option of a Bootstrap /popper. "week" Goes to a week view, as determined by the views in the headerToolbar. I use Angular 2 module (ap-angular2-fullcalendar). 4k 25 25 gold badges 198 198 silver badges 267 267 bronze badges. Bootstrap CSS breaks tooltip popover. As the popovers are bound to the . Popover #4138. – ADyson Aug 1, 2018 at 5:10In the documentation of react-big-calendar prop-onSelectEvent you see that the SyntheticEvent is the second argument. Try using a popover instead of a tooltip, it's better than a tooltip if you wanna add more info to it. 1)で検証してみます。. preventDefault() on the given native JS event. 1. The problem is caused by null offsetParent. I tried to use qtip and material MatToolTip libraries but without success (I managed to add tooltip to DOM but it is not. For timeGrid and timeline views, see eventMaxStack. I'm trying to update Fullcalendar in v5 in my angular app. mouseEnterInfo is a plain object with the following properties: The associated Event Object. The following pre-configured timeline views are available: timelineDay, timelineWeek, timelineMonth, and timelineYear. js? 0. If anyone knows any solution using either the fullCalendar popover method (without jquery) or displaying via ng-template, any help in this regard would be appreciated. 2. 1. Bootstrap popovers with Fullcalendar - double click to show? 0. Click any example below to run it instantly or find templates that can be used as a pre-built solution!Hello Eduardo, Thanks for the sugestion. Load 7 more related. The other option is to change FullCalendar's source code but I disagree with this option. there is a view for displaying the event info and another for updating the view). 1. js. Having a bootstrap3 popover appearing in the bottom of an event in fullcalendar. Teams. With this code I dont have a problem in my consol but also nothing is displayingIt is recommended to import @fullcalendar/core/vdom before any other imports. 0. “popover”, “week”, “day”, view name (string), function. I have binded events from a json file. You can easily solve the conflict by just adding 2 simple CSS. That's not a fullCalendar feature? It feels like it is. My popover goes under div and a part of him not showing is hidden. title: string "" Specifies the header text of the popover: Try it: trigger: string "click" Specifies how the popover is triggered. pointer-events: auto !important. 13template property will be passed from our main component so we can create any template we want. ngStra. Firstly friends we need fresh angular 10 setup and for this we need to run below commands but if you already have angular 10 setup then you can avoid below commands. 1 Answer. "popover" (the default) Displays a rectangular panel over the cell with a full list of events for that day. "When using fullCalendar with version 2. fullcalendar popover not big enough when eventLimit used. event. to fix this bug, the best solution is to have the popover div NOT be within the scroll container, unlike it is now. And I get this error: When using JQuery: TypeError: $(. With CodeSandbox, you can easily learn how acestudiooleg has skilfully integrated different packages and frameworks to create. The CSS I am using is what the FullCalendar website provides. Could anyone confirm that the popover is scrollable in iOS (safari and native app), please? Have tried setting height and max-height and overflow-y:auto/scroll/visible. The div that gets created has the . Limits the number of events displayed on a day. it shows it in the more link cause u have too mutch elements on that day (Mostly at month view) – brandelizer. Follow asked Sep 14, 2014 at 10:19. Click here for making today button active. extendedProps. But the function ("detailcheck") created is not working . However, it's not too difficult. fc-popover . When you click the "+2 more" button, then click on an event inside that . Events in popover. By the description you have, I'm assuming these will be all day events. Is there an after or some other event I can wire. popover, but that didn't work either. This can be seen in the case of a timeGridWeek event spanning multiple columns, where each event “segment” (individual span of time after slicing) is rendered with individual elements. To see if this is a Salesforce issue, are you able to reproduce it in non-Salesforce context?fullcalendar / fullcalendar Public. Props and Emitted Events. If you click the '+3 more' on March 13 the popover will open , then you have to drag the last event on the list ( which is Dinner at 8p ) and drop it on March 20 and it won't work .